Which country made football popular?

Modern football originated in Britain in the 19th century. Though “folk football” had been played since medieval times with varying rules, the game began to be standardized when it was taken up as a winter game at public schools.

Who invented football Canada or USA?

American football evolved in the United States, originating from the sports of soccer and rugby. The first American football match was played on November 6, 1869, between two college teams, Rutgers and Princeton, using rules based on the rules of soccer at the time.

What is the oldest sport?

Wrestling – Wrestling is regarded the oldest sports in the world and we have proof. The famous cave paintings in Lascaux, France, dating back to 15,300 years ago, depict wrestlers.

Which country invented most sports?

Think about the world's major sports for a minute and you'll realize that many of them were invented in Britain. Number one in the world for popularity is soccer, not far behind, come cricket, tennis, and golf, all of which started out in Britain. Second-tier sports like badminton and rugby also originated there.

What was before the NFL?

The National Football League (NFL) was founded in 1920 as the American Professional Football Association (APFA) with ten teams from four states, all of whom existed in some form as participants of regional leagues in their respective territories.

Why is NFL not popular outside US?

1) No tradition established in other countries. 2) The rules are more complicated than most sports. 3) Similar sports are already popular in many major countries (Australian Rules Football, Rugby League, and Rugby Union). 4) It is a violent sport with many injuries.

Is American football popular in Mexico?

The most popular sport in Mexico currently is association football followed by boxing. However, there are regional variations: for example, baseball is the most popular sport in the northwest and the southeast of the country. Basketball, American football and bull riding (called "Jaripeo") are also popular.
